Overview
PT-141, also known as bremelanotide, is a synthetic cyclic heptapeptide developed as a melanocortin receptor agonist. Structurally it is a close relative of Melanotan II: the C-terminal amide of MT-2 is replaced by a free carboxylic acid, which removes most of the pigmentation-related MC1R activity and shifts the molecule’s preference toward the central MC3R and MC4R subtypes. The lactam bridge between the aspartate and lysine side chains, the N-terminal acetyl group, and the inclusion of norleucine and D-phenylalanine all contribute to its conformational rigidity and resistance to enzymatic degradation.

What is PT-141 and how does it differ from Melanotan II?
PT-141 (bremelanotide) is the free-acid, deaminated analogue of Melanotan II. That single structural change lowers activity at the pigmentation-linked MC1R while preserving MC3R and MC4R agonism, which is why researchers use PT-141 when they want central melanocortin signalling with less peripheral melanogenic activity.

Does PT-141 cause tanning like Melanotan II?
The pigmentation response reported in Melanotan II literature is driven largely by MC1R activation, and PT-141’s affinity for that receptor is considerably lower.
